Outline of Final Research Achievements

Metal complexes containing hydride units play a key role in a range of chemical processes such as energy conversion and hydrogen storage applications. However, there have been critical issues including safety and environmental load because hydride sources such as H2 gas are used for the synthesis of conventional hydride complexes. In this study, novel strategies were established for selective synthesis of ruthenium complexes containing three types of metal- and/or organic-hydride units in the absence of H2 gas. Furthermore, it was confirmed that the organic-hydride was more excellent than the corresponding metal-hydride when hydrogen donating abilities to some substrates were examined using three kinds of the prepared hydride complexes.
